Handover note — Crumbwheel order cutoffs.

Welcome aboard. The bakery cutoff rule in Crumbwheel closes same-day orders at 14:00 local to each storefront, not UTC — this has bitten us twice. Holiday overrides live in the calendar service and take precedence silently, so always check there first when a cutoff looks wrong. To unlock the calendar service's admin console after a restart, enter the recovery passphrase below.

vault phrase of bagap-bahaf = silion-pelox-sorox-casdor-quenwyn-fraax-eliox-praael-kelion-quenvan-kasox-rusael-norius-belvan

Hey Marisol,

Handing over the pager for SpoolHawk, our printer-spooler microservice. Quick notes for this week: the retry queue backed up twice after the Quillford datacenter failover, and I bumped the worker count to 6 as a stopgap. Plugin authors keep hitting the new manifest validation, so expect a few tickets about rejected print jobs — point them at the v3 plugin guide. Everything else is green.

If external plugin folks need help beyond the docs, tell them to reach out here.

escalation mailbox, bafog-fafog: ulador@paliqlabs.internal

## Deploying the Gatewick Proctor Queue

Deploys are pretty painless: push to main, wait for the pipeline, then watch the queue drain dashboard for five minutes. If candidates pile up mid-exam, roll back first and ask questions later — the queue replays safely. Everything the workers care about lives in one config block, shown here for reference.

settings of bafof-yagef:
JOROX_PIN=8740
JOROX_TENANT=pelox
JOROX_METRICS_HOST=metrics.jorox.qorvelworks.internal
JOROX_SEAL=seal_c78f63c1
JOROX_STANDBY_TEAM=norax